Kickapoo Tribe in Kansas Water Rights Settlement Agreement
This bill ratifies and modifies the Kickapoo Tribe Water Rights Settlement Agreement entered into by the tribe, Kansas, and the United States. The bill confirms a consumptive tribal water right in the Delaware River Basin of up to 4,705 acre-feet of water per year.
